thanks for the kind words and the list of issues. We are trying to get 
all of them reproduced, so that I can hunt them down :) If you can 
reproduce the freezing issues or where the UI crashed, it would be great 
if you could open a ticket on http://www.paroli-project.org/trac and 
attach the paroli log and the fso log (/var/log/paroli.log and 
/var/log/frameworkd.log).

> ¤ How to connect to a hidden WLAN network? How about encryptions?

WPA,WEP and WPA2 should be handled correctly. This should also cover 90% 
of all cases. I would love to have a more complete interface for wifi, 
but am afraid I won't have the time. If there is anyone who wants to 
adopt the whole wifi settings part (is only one py file) let me know and 
I'll get him/her git access along with all the help I can provide.

Any care-taker?

The same goes for any settings option you want to work on. It should be 
fairly easy to get into that part of paroli and a good way to get into 
the rest as well ;)
